EMPHASIS: Results Of DWI Enforcement Programs Conducted In Troop B During The Month Of July 2014


Captain James E. Wilt, commanding officer of Troop B, Macon, announces the results of DWI (driving while intoxicated) saturations conducted in Adair, Linn, Marion, Monroe, Ralls, and Shelby counties. The saturations were held from 11:00 p.m. to 3:00 a.m. on July 5, 12, 18, and 19. During these enforcement operations, officers patrolled specific areas with a goal of detecting impaired drivers and other traffic violations that contribute to traffic crashes. As a result of the operations, officers made eight arrests, and issued 15 traffic citations and 93 warnings. The following is a list of enforcement contacts made during the saturations:

3 -- Arrests for driving while intoxicated.
5 -- Arrests for misdemeanor drug violations.
4 -- Citations were issued for exceeding the speed limit.
4 -- Citations were issued for seat belt violations.
2 -- Citations were issued for hazardous moving violations.
5 -- Citations were issued for insurance violations.

"The Patrol will conduct more traffic enforcement programs in the upcoming months," stated Captain Wilt. "The Missouri State Highway Patrol is very serious about removing the impaired driver from our roadways. If drinking is a part of your plans, choose a sober designated driver."
